Transaction 959511acab80c59289b07679217ad079d77e165b1ab36c8292e69c7d3ac193cd
1 Input
1 Output
-
959511acab80c59289b07679217ad079d77e165b1ab36c8292e69c7d3ac193cd:0
- value
- 50000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 40d6430b2eb963deefbd6a222aba103d90bdb459 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16upvTLxz9rvPMyryPGPpRDpD7LD12XyvF